Here goes folks!

Kickpanels: 3.5” Wolfengang 80w 86db (pr) $25

Center dash: 4x6 Pioneer 20w 91 db $20
Trunk: 10” Pioneer sub, 120w 90 db $50

Head Unit: VR3 4x21w, 4 RCA outs $85

Amp: Rampage 4x75 RMS with 50-250Hz low pass $85

High pass filters for 3.5”: 200 Hz 6db $6

Resistors for 4x6”: Pair 25w 27 ohm $6
Power wire: 20’ 10 gauge $5
Speaker wire 18 ga $5

Sub box 9x15x15x˝” MDF $12

1965 four door ford uses a 40 amp alternator

I have spent a lot of time cruising the 12 volt. Learned here how to make kickpanel pods, what filters and resistors are for and much more. While no one will accuse me of overspending, I do want to get the maximum out of my $300 investment.

The install will finish up this weekend. Right now I worry the most about the center dash speaker – how can I (if I can) get it to gracefully fill between the subwoofer and the kickpanel speakers? But maybe there are other weak links too?
